Shell Building
Shell Building is a renovation/alteration project at 1500 Colcord, Waco, in McLennan County, TX, tracked from its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R) registration. Construction complete (TDLR inspection passed Dec 2019). The project has an estimated value of $235K across about 2,350 sq ft.

Shell Building is a Renovation/Alteration project located at 1500 Colcord, Waco, TX 76707 in Waco, Texas. The project has an estimated value of $235K covering 2,350 sq ft. Mission Waco is the property owner and Winton Engineering, Inc. is the design firm of record. The project was registered with TDLR on July 17, 2019.

๐Scope of Work
Renovations to rebuild a building damaged by a roof collapse for future lease space use.
Note: This project is registered under the Texas Accessibility Standards (TAS) program. TDLR registration is required for commercial and public facility construction to ensure compliance with accessibility requirements under Texas Government Code Chapter 469.
